perl-modperl-cvs m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From do...@locus.apache.org
Subject cvs commit: modperl/src/modules/perl mod_perl.c
Date Mon, 06 Mar 2000 00:17:07 GMT
dougm       00/03/05 16:17:07

  Modified:    src/modules/perl mod_perl.c
  Log:
  grr, breakage in subrequests, dont care why right now
  
  Revision  Changes    Path
  1.102     +8 -2      modperl/src/modules/perl/mod_perl.c
  
  Index: mod_perl.c
  ===================================================================
  RCS file: /home/cvs/modperl/src/modules/perl/mod_perl.c,v
  retrieving revision 1.101
  retrieving revision 1.102
  diff -u -r1.101 -r1.102
  --- mod_perl.c	2000/03/05 23:45:00	1.101
  +++ mod_perl.c	2000/03/06 00:17:06	1.102
  @@ -1331,9 +1331,15 @@
   	cfg->setup_env = 0; /* just once per-request */
       }
   
  -    (void)perl_request_rec(r);
  -
       if(callbacks_this_request++ > 0) return;
  +
  +    if (!r->main) {
  +	/* so Apache->request will work before PerlHandler with CGI.pm
  +	 * XXX: triggers core dump in subrequests, 
  +	 * so just do in the main request for now
  +	 */
  +	(void)perl_request_rec(r);
  +    }
   
       /* PerlSetEnv */
       mod_perl_dir_env(r, cld);
  
  
  

Mime
View raw message